Title: Michel Nertz: Innovator in Laser-Induced Fluorescence Technology
Introduction
Michel Nertz is a notable inventor based in Sainte Foy d'Aigrefeuille, France. He has made significant contributions to the field of laser-induced fluorescence technology, holding 2 patents that showcase his innovative approach to analysis devices.
Latest Patents
Nertz's latest patents include a laser-induced fluorescence analysis device and a laser-induced fluorescence detector with a capillary detection cell. The analysis device features a tube with a channel that guides fluorescence light, utilizing a collecting member designed to capture this light effectively. The detector comprises a laser beam emitting device, a dichroic mirror, and a unique capillary cell that enhances the analysis of fluorescent substances.
